Output 0ba80bcabde73c797925520037d168a544229a21954fed8c84047934e7e2328e:4

value
103553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19daf88afc0ff5f76d5d29e6acef2da56bd6bdfc OP_EQUAL
address
343j8hgvPM2PhbPtibsUufCfDYHerJdoUZ
transaction
0ba80bcabde73c797925520037d168a544229a21954fed8c84047934e7e2328e
spent
true